WebDec 21, 2016 · Coffee is acidic, and so are coffee grounds. This can throw off the pH in the worm bin and create problems. Therefore, mixing crushed eggshells with coffee grounds will help neutralize the acid. If you run a coffee shop or restaurant, experiment to find the right mix of coffee grounds and crushed eggshells. WebDec 6, 2024 · To feed individual rose bushes, gently remove about 1 inch of soil in a circular trench around the bush's base. After scattering the chopped peels in this circular trench, backfill it with soil and replace mulch, if necessary. The bananas break down gradually over time.
